Retailer: Star Ocean PSP Remakes Heading Stateside This Fall

by Mike Bendel on April 29, 2008 @ 12:46 pm


According to online retailer GameFly, PSP titles Star Ocean: First Departure and Star Ocean: Second Evolution are both penned for a stateside debut this fall. The rental site actually goes as far to date the pair of remakes, listing a September 30 release date for each. However, we assume this date is nothing more than a placeholder, so don’t rush to mark your calendars just yet.

Now to patiently wait for the official announcement from Square Enix.
